CALENDAR CHANGES DUE TO WEATHER: At the ACPS School Board Budget Work session on February 20, 2025, several members of the Board expressed concerns about the loss of seat time/ instructional time, especially for 2nd semester, due to our inclement weather days in January and February. Therefore, they approved a motion to add back instructional time with the follow revisions to the 2024-2025 ACPS Calendar:
April 7, 2025 will now be a REGULAR school day instead of the scheduled Teacher Workday/School Professional Development Day. Additionally, April 18, 2025 will now be a FULL school day instead of a 1:00 early dismissal.

Attention Rising 7th and 12th graders. Please schedule now to receive required vaccines for next school year and turn in documentation early. Documentation can include a medical exemption form, a notarized Religious exemption form or documentation of vaccine administration.
Required vaccines for rising 7th graders are the Tdap and Meningitis. HPV is required but parents can opt out.
Rising 12th graders need at least 1 Meningitis vaccine.
For the Fort, Stewart and BMMS students, the Health Dept will be coming to campus on April 19th to administer. Consent forms can be obtained at your child's school. Vaccines will not be administered without parental consent.
If you have questions, please reach out to your school nurse.

During the week of November 6-10, 2023 schools throughout the United States will celebrate National School Psychology Week (NSPW) to highlight the important work school psychologists and other educators do to help all students thrive. This year's theme is "Let's Grow Together," inspired by the importance of both personal and shared strengths in our growth as individuals and school communities in every season of life. The theme recognizes every aspect of growth, as fundamental to effective learning environments and to school psychologists' role in supporting student well-being and learning. -National Association of School Psychologists
